Concrete is a porous substance. While it requires water to produce, place and cure it, concrete is not compatible with it afterwards. In fact, it needs to be protected from the potential damage that can be caused by water. Water can cause cracks and other chinks to appear in the surface. This, in turn, can cause structural damage and increase the costs of maintenance, let alone affect the safety of any who use or are in close proximity to concrete construction. Concrete Waterproofing Technology
Concrete waterproofing is not a single type. Technology has made it possible to protect concrete from water using one of several different methods. Among them are the following:
1. Liquid Membrane Concrete Waterproofing: A liquid membrane is liquid and forms a membrane on the concrete’s surface. It goes on liquid and becomes a rubbery coating. You apply a polyurethane liquid membrane in one of several ways. These are: spray, roller or trowel. Each method requires a separate grade of liquid membrane.
2. Sheet Membrane Concrete Waterproofing: These come in large, square sheets usually of rubberized asphalt membranes. The material is very rubber-like and sticky. It self-adheres to the walls where the soil is going to be placed. This is more expensive and less effective than pure liquid concrete waterproofing although it can be easily applied uniformly.
3. Cementitious Waterproofing: This substance is applied directly to the concrete. It hardens and becomes as uniform as the base surface while providing that extra protection. Many favor it because of its user-friendliness.
4. Bentonite Concrete Waterproofing: These come in pre-prepared sheets. The waterproofing substance is layered between two sheets. The sheets are applied to the concrete. It protective qualities are only activated in the presence of water which means you cannot view the results. Yet, this method, shunned by some because of this characteristic, is a method that is easy in application, quick to use and even has the benefit of being both save and not harmful for the environment.
